Optimizing Readability Across All Devices
One of the biggest concerns when choosing a bold typeface is legibility. Does it work on a 6-inch phone screen? Is it clear over a busy image background? During our testing phase, we put Questiora to the test on various devices. The result was impressive. The open counters and strong structure of the letters ensure that even in small previews, the text remains sharp and easy to decipher.
We found that Questiora works exceptionally well as a short headline or a callout rather than body copy. For supporting text, we paired it with a clean, modern sans serif font. This combination creates a perfect balance: Questiora grabs attention, while the secondary font provides clarity for the details. This approach is crucial for digital ads and web design where space is limited.
When creating thumbnails for video content, we often overlay text on complex images. The high contrast of Questiora stands out beautifully against both dark backgrounds and light overlays. It prevents the "muddy" look that happens when thin lines get lost in photography. Mastering Font Pairing and Style Variations
To get the most out of Questiora, understanding how to pair it is essential. Because it is such a dominant display font, it needs a partner that lets it shine without competing. We recommend pairing it with a neutral, clean modern typography system like a geometric sans serif or a classic serif font for editorial layouts. If you are aiming for a more playful vibe, a subtle script font or handwritten font can add a human touch for secondary details, though this should be done sparingly.
Before diving into the full campaign, we checked the included styles and alternates. Questiora comes with a range of weights that allow for nuanced design choices. Some campaigns benefit from the heavy, impactful weights for headlines, while others might use lighter variants for subheaders. Checking the file formats and multilingual support is also a smart move if you plan to run international ads or create merchandise. Ensuring you have the correct commercial font licensing is vital for client campaigns and digital products.
